Simple, direct, and penetrating, the celebrated photographer
Timothy Greenfield-Sanders portrays his subjects like a painter
from another age. Thanks to his 11x14" Fulmer & Schwing, an old
wooden box dated 1905, which he uses as if he were using a palette
and brush, he produces portraits that are rich in detail without
being overly psychological. The poignant poses and expressions he
captures in his straightforward images convey a sense of the
person. Like Rembrandt and Velazquez depicting the great figures of
their time, Greenfield-Sanders focuses his lens on today's icons:
artists, architects, writers, scientists, actors, directors,
musicians artists, architects. Undoubtedly one of
Greenfield-Sanders's greatest merits is his being able to limit the
distance that separates the portrait from the observer. This
beautifully produced volume brings together an impressive selection
of portraits taken between 1977 and the present with over 100 never
published before. The juxtaposition of the portraits adds a
compelling dimension to the individual portraits. The intensity of
Elaine and Willem de Kooning or Norman Mailer and Gore Vidal
multiplies as they appear next to each other on the page. William
Wegman and Richard Hamilton lean toward each other, toward some
kind of cosmic center. Martin Scorsese and Steven Spielberg seem to
confirm the notion that a director is in total control. And porn
star Briana Banks, look every bit like a porn star.
